ESD Trays by Insulink – Ensuring Safe Handling of Sensitive Electronics

In electronics manufacturing and storage, protecting components from electrostatic discharge (ESD) is essential. Even small static charges can damage sensitive devices, causing hidden defects or complete failures. To prevent such risks, industries use ESD Trays for safe storage, handling, and transportation of electronic components. Insulink offers high-quality ESD Trays that provide reliable static protection, durability, and operational efficiency. What Are ESD Trays? ESD Trays are specialized trays made from electrostatic dissipative or conductive materials. They safely disperse static charges, preventing sudden discharge that could damage electronic components. Commonly used for: Printed Circuit Boards (PCBs) Integrated Circuits (ICs) Semiconductors Connectors and modules Unlike ordinary trays, ESD trays maintain a static-safe environment, safeguarding components throughout the handling process.
